U.S. Treasury Sanctions BDL Ex-Governor Riad Salameh

Reuters Iraq Bureau Chief reported this morning that the U.S. Treasury has sanctioned former Lebanese central bank governor Riad Salameh, along with his brother Raja, his son Nadi, his aide Marianne Howayek and his lover Anna Kosakova. Al Arabiya also confirmed the story and referred to a notice posted on the Treasury Department website. This comes only one week after Salameh left office. All are suspected of money laundering. Saudi Arabia & Bahrain Urge Their Citizens To Leave Lebanon

Saudi Arabia was the first to issue a travel warning to Lebanon following the ongoing clashes at Ain el Helwe camp, followed by Kuwait, Bahrain & Qatar. While Saudi Arabia & Bahrain urged their citizens to leave Lebanon quickly, Kuwait & Qatar advised their citizens to avoid places that are witnessing conflict but stopped short of urging their citizens to leave.
